MPV Properties is seeking an Association Property Assistant. This position is responsible for handling administrative functions relating to the daily operation of the commercial Association Portfolio and project support to the Association Operations team. MPV Properties is one of the Charlotte area’s leading commercial real estate firms offering office, industrial, retail and land brokerage, development, and property management services, and has been named a Top Workplace for the past 11 years.
Responsibilities
Association work order management and tracking in ANGUS
Initiate vendor dispatch for all service requests
Log operating property work orders in ANGUS system
Coordinate access between vendors and owners for service
Follow up with vendors to ensure completion of work orders to close out
Prepare property work order reports for weekly inspections and as requested
Maintain preventative maintenance tracking in ANGUS
Maintain logs and schedule Roof, Fire/Life Safety, Backflow, Extinguisher, Elevator, Lighting, Sweeping, and Pressure Washing
Building access control system management and updates
Review Day Porter Reports for ANGUS Input
Maintain vendor contract and renewal spreadsheets
Maintain Association Property Recurring Charges Log
Maintain Property Information Spreadsheets
Handle utility transfers as needed
Association notice communications as needed
Provide support to Senior Association Manager and Director of Associations as needed
Other tasks as assigned
